Daniel Hickey is an experienced marketing professional and content strategist with a strong background in the gaming and media industries. Currently serving as Xbox Marketing Program Manager at Hanson Consulting Group, Daniel has previously worked in various roles including Account Executive at Spear Marketing Group, where significant achievements included launching targeted email campaigns for Microsoft. Daniel's extensive experience at Microsoft encompasses positions such as Senior Producer for Xbox Live, where management of subscriptions content programming was pivotal. Written works include contributions to newsletters, promotional campaigns, and scripted content for independent films. Daniel holds a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ree from New York University.

Hanson Consulting Group is a WBENC- Certified Women’s Business Enterprise (we’re pretty darned proud of that). We connect professionals with leading technology, gaming, and entertainment businesses in the greater Seattle area and in the UK. Our mission is to deliver the value and results necessary to help our clients succeed. Yes, we are consultants. But first and foremost, we are a group of incredibly talented fun-to-be-around people our clients genuinely enjoy working with. We love what we do, and we love where we work. Our team has extensive experience in product, program and business management, marketing, gaming technology, application development and business analysis. As a specialty business and IT consulting firm, Hanson Consulting Group connects business, IT and gaming professionals to Seattle and Eastside technology, gaming, and healthcare companies.
